Dubai's Photovoltaic Ambitions: Goals and Progress

Dubai is aggressively implementing a ambitious vision for clean energy, with solar power at the forefront of its strategy. The Dubai Clean Energy Strategy 2050 targets to generate 75% of Dubai's total power output from sustainable energy sources by the year 2050, a impressive shift from current reliance on traditional fuels. Progress is being achieved through various large-scale projects, including the Mohammed bin Rashid Al Maktoum PV Park, which is currently one of most extensive solar parks in the world. Early phases of the park are already operational, and further developments are planned to attain the city's expanding energy requirements. Investment in innovative photovoltaic technologies and partnerships with major energy companies are furthermore facilitating a crucial part in achieving these ambitious targets.

Photovoltaic Power Dubai: Benefits and Drawbacks

Dubai's pursuit to a sustainable era is prominently displayed in its increasingly embraced sun power sector. The upsides are obvious: reduced reliance on fossil fuels, lower energy costs for consumers, a decreased ecological effect, and the generation of sustainable employment. However, notable challenges exist. The intense desert heat might reduce PV module efficiency, necessitating more frequent cleaning and advanced cooling approaches. Furthermore, the website upfront investment costs remain considerable, although government incentives are aiding to reduce this expense. Finally, land availability for major photovoltaic plants poses a considerable obstacle to widespread adoption.
